hey guys, sorry if this is a repost, but has anyone tried replacing the bulbs in their gauge cluster with led's from ledautomotive?

my reverse glow gauges have been taken out due to many problems after 1 year of use. I am looking at getting a set of led's, but I dunno if the light output justifies the 30$ cost. Btw, does anyone know if hyperwhite led's looks good? (or if they just show up plain blue)

theylll show up as a light blue because of the light filter on the back of the gauges. in order for you to make them shine thru white, youd have to take off the stock gauge backing, and the needles, and wipre out teh areas behind the numbers and stuff....not exactally easy or something id suggest doing.
